Electron Microscopic Observations on Virus-Like Particles Associated with SH Antigen
Authors:P T Jokelainen  Kai Krohn  A M Prince  and N D C Finlayson
Institution:Department of Anatomy, New York Medical College, New York, New York 10029;Division of Gastroenterology, Department of Medicine, and Department of Pathology, Cornell University Medical College, New York, New York 10021;Laboratory of Virology, The New York Blood Center, New York, New York 10021
Abstract:The structural aspects of SH antigen-containing particles were investigated. These studies confirmed the existence of a large spherical particle (ca. 43 nm) and smaller (ca. 20 nm) rod- and sphere-shaped particles. The large particle consists of an outer and inner membrane and a core of "nucleic acid" as seen by positive staining techniques. The outer membrane of the large particle appears to be similar to that of the 20-nm diameter spheres and rods known to possess the SH antigen.
